Why Choose Pigeon Control Nets?
Pigeons can create multiple issues when they settle on buildings. Their droppings can stain walls, corrode surfaces, and lead to unpleasant odors. Nesting materials may block drainage systems, ventilation ducts, and other critical areas, causing maintenance problems. Pigeon control nets act as a physical barrier that prevents birds from accessing these areas, eliminating the root cause of these issues.
One of the key advantages of pigeon control nets is that they offer a humane solution. They do not harm the birds but simply restrict access, encouraging them to find alternative locations. This makes them an environmentally friendly choice compared to chemical repellents or other harmful methods.

Installation Process
Professional installation ensures that pigeon control nets deliver maximum effectiveness. The installation begins with a detailed site inspection to assess the building layout, measure the required coverage, and identify all potential entry points for birds.
The nets are then installed using strong hooks, clamps, and support wires attached to walls, ceilings, or frames. Proper tensioning ensures the nets remain tight and secure, preventing pigeons from entering. Complete coverage is essential to ensure that no gaps remain where birds could gain access.

Maintenance Tips
Maintaining pigeon control nets is simple and ensures long-term effectiveness. Regular cleaning helps remove accumulated dust, feathers, and debris. Periodic inspection is recommended to check for any damage or loose fittings, and any issues should be repaired promptly to maintain full protection.
With proper maintenance, high-quality pigeon control nets can last for many years, providing consistent safety and value for money.
